| SHEPHERD'S ARMS (Temperance Inn) [Kirk Yetholm] | Shepherds Arms (Temperance Inn) |
Mr. Fleming Grocer Mr George Kerr Sign board on front |
017.01 | A temperance Inn in name, though in reality a common lodging house, and only resorted to by Tinkers and people of the lower order the accomodation, and entertainment are of a kind corresponding to the requirements of the Class, who resort to the house the present occupier is P Mulligan |

This volume contains information on place names found in the parish of Yetholm.
Ordnance Survey - Roxburgh county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county. This entry has been created to enable searching for Ordnance Survey records for the county of Roxburgh, which is in the south east of Scotland. The boundaries of the county were altered by the Boundary Commissioners in 1891.
